From Reactive to Predictive: The New Urban Mindset



Cities made use of to run reactively. A traffic light malfunctions? Someone fixes it. Does a bus route become overcrowded? Coordinators modified it months later. But with AI, this timeline has flipped. Sensing units positioned at junctions, transportation centers, and hectic roads feed real-time data into AI-powered systems that can not only react immediately but also predict what's following.



Visualize a system that recognizes when and where blockage will build prior to it also occurs. That's no longer a dream. By examining patterns gradually, like pedestrian traffic, weather conditions, and occasion routines, AI models aid cities prevent traffic jams rather than just responding to them.



Smarter Traffic Signals and Intersection Management



One of one of the most recognizable enhancements AI has actually given urban transport is in the method traffic signal run. Standard signal systems work on timers or straightforward sensors. Yet AI can evaluate real-time footage, find car quantity, and adapt light cycles on the fly. This shift lowers unnecessary idling, enhances gas efficiency, and-- probably most importantly-- shortens commute times.



Some cities have started to match AI-powered cams with traffic control to identify not just lorries, but pedestrians and cyclists also. This permits signals to change for vulnerable road customers, boosting security without reducing overall website traffic circulation.



Public Transit Gets a High-Tech Upgrade



Buses and trains are important lifelines in most cities. Yet delays, path inefficiencies, and maintenance issues typically discourage bikers. That's starting to change with the help of AI.



Transportation firms are currently making use of predictive analytics to take care of fleets much better. If a bus is running behind schedule, AI can suggest route adjustments, alternating pick-up factors, or even reassign vehicles in real-time. Maintenance is also more positive; AI recognizes very early indication before parts stop working, which keeps vehicles on the road and bikers on schedule.



When public transport corresponds and trustworthy, even more people use it. And when even more people use public transportation, cities end up being greener, less stuffed, and less complicated to navigate.



Redefining Parking with Smart Systems



Finding a vehicle parking spot in a city can be one of the most aggravating part of driving. It's taxing, difficult, and frequently ineffective. However AI is currently altering the means cities deal with car parking monitoring.



Video cameras and sensing units installed in parking area and garages track available spaces and send out updates to central systems. Chauffeurs can after that be guided to open up places through navigation applications or in-car systems, reducing the time they invest circling around the block. In turn, this cuts discharges and makes city roads much less crowded.



Some AI systems are also capable of dynamic prices, readjusting car parking charges based upon need in real time. This discourages overuse in crowded zones and motivates turn over, offering everyone a fairer shot at discovering an area.

The Rise of Autonomous Vehicles and Ridesharing Intelligence



While self-driving cars and trucks may not yet dominate the roadways, they're most definitely influencing the direction of urban transport. AI is the foundation of autonomous car modern technology, handling everything from navigation to challenge discovery and feedback time.



But even before full autonomy takes hold, AI is already transforming ridesharing solutions. Formulas assist set guests extra efficiently, reduce wait times, and recommend tactical areas for drivers to wait in between prices. Gradually, these understandings will certainly help in reducing traffic congestion and enhance automobile occupancy rates throughout cities.



There's additionally been a rise in AI-enhanced micro movement choices like scooters and bike shares. These services are taken care of by AI systems that track use patterns, anticipate high-demand areas, and even detect upkeep demands immediately.



Planning the Future: AI and Urban Design



City planners currently have an effective new ally in expert system. With accessibility to massive datasets-- everything from traveler behaviors to air high quality levels-- AI devices can model the impact of framework modifications prior to they're also made. This means far better decisions about where to put bike lanes, how to boost bus paths, or whether to construct new bridges and passages.



Urban programmers can likewise use AI to design the effect of new zoning regulations or domestic development on transportation systems. This brings about smarter development that sustains movement rather than frustrating it.

More Secure Streets Through Real-Time Intelligence



AI is not just about speed and performance-- it's also regarding safety and security. From recognizing speeding cars in real time to anticipating accident-prone areas, AI is helping make streets much safer for everybody.



Smart security systems powered by machine learning can discover hazardous actions, such as illegal turns, running red lights, or jaywalking. These systems don't just serve as deterrents; they produce information that cities can utilize to educate future security efforts.



AI is likewise assisting very first -responders reach emergencies quicker. Real-time web traffic analysis can direct ambulances along the quickest route, even throughout heavy traffic. And when secs count, those time cost savings can be life-changing.
